Starting her career at 15, Malaysian star Eyka Farhana already has over a decade of experience under her belt—and she’s not slowing down. Practically raised in the spotlight, she’s appeared in films, television dramas, telefilms, web series, and more. With time, her style evolved just as much as her craft, making her one of Malaysia’s most fashion-forward stars.

From Extra to Excellence
Farhana entered showbiz in 2010 to help her family, beginning with small roles until she was discovered in the 2011 TV series Gemilang. Soon after, she landed lead and supporting roles in numerous television films and dramas.

In 2015, the actress made the leap to cinema. Since then, her portfolio and fanbase have grown, solidifying her status as one of Malaysia’s most sought-after stars. Among her standout roles, her performance in Pretty Little Liars Indonesia earned her the Best Actress award from the Asian Academy Creative Awards, granting her international acclaim in 2020.
Small Frame, Big Fashion Energy
Farhana doesn’t let her petite frame limit her self-expression. With fearless confidence and creativity, her signature style has caught the attention of fashion powerhouses: Ralph Lauren, Dior, Longchamp, and even Gentle Monster, who named her their muse in 2023. She’s also made appearances at fashion weeks in New York and Kuala Lumpur—where she walked for L’Oréal Paris Malaysia in 2024.

With a thriving career and a style uniquely her own, Eyka Farhana is poised to make waves far beyond Malaysia. Having already conquered both entertainment and fashion milestones, it’s only a matter of time before her influence resonates across Asia—and beyond.
